To take minutes of Management Committee meetings and the odd extra meeting if required, and distribute them for the following meeting.

We’re looking for a helpful and organised volunteers from the village of Whitminster to support our committee by taking meeting minutes. If you enjoy writing things up clearly and can spare a little time, this is a great way to get involved and make a difference in your community.

Key Tasks:

  • Attend committee meetings (usually once every 2 months)
  • Take clear and accurate notes during meetings
  • Type up the minutes and share them with the committee
  • Help keep track of decisions and actions agreed at meetings
  • Keep copies of meeting minutes organised and accessible in the minute book.

Time Commitment:

Around 2–3 hours per meeting, including time to write up the minutes.

What you’ll need:

  • Good listening and writing skills
  • Comfortable using email and basic word processing
  • Reliable and able to maintain confidentiality when needed


This opportunity would suit a retiree with a Secretarial/administration background or someone who would like to follow a career in Administration and would like to use this position to add as experience on a CV.
